The Constitution of India - Arabic Translation

The Republic of India is governed in terms of the Constitution of India which was adopted by the Constituent Assembly on 26th November 1949 and came into force on 26th January 1950.

The Constitution of India lays down the framework defining fundamental political principles, procedures, powers and duties of government institutions and sets out Fundamental Rights, Directive Principles of State Policies and also the Duties of its Citizens.

The Arabic  language translation of the full text of the Constitution of India was formally released on 8 December, 2014 at the Headquarters of the League of Arab States (LAS) in Cairo by Mr. Anil Wadhwa, Secretary (East), Ministry of External Affairs, Government of India and Dr. Nabi El Araby, Secretary General of the League of Arab States.
